Where are the email settings on my iPad?
Apple iPad – Email Account Settings (Personal POP / IMAP) To find specific settings for your email provider, use the mail settings lookup tool. From a Home screen on your Apple® iPad®, navigate: Settings > Mail > Accounts. If unavailable, navigate: Settings > Passwords & Accounts.
How do I set up a SMTP server on my iPad?
And here’s how to set up an SMTP for your iPad. 1. Select “Settings > Mail, Contacts, Calendars”. 2. Tap the email account from which you want to send emails (or add a new one if it’s the case). 3. Tap “SMTP” under “Outgoing Mail Server”. 4. Tap “Add Server…”.

How do I set up an email account?
Then follow these steps: Go to Settings > Passwords & Accounts. Tap Add Account, tap Other, then tap Add Mail Account. Enter your name, email address, password, and a description for your account. Tap Next. Mail will try to find the email settings and finish your account setup.
